私はいくつかのユーザー コントロールを持つ古いプロジェクトに取り組んでいます。Web サイトでは、これらのコントロールの 1 つが次のように呼び出されています。
<form id="frmDesignation" runat="server" >
<table><tr><td>
<sidenav:menu runat="server" ID="mymenu"></sidenav:menu>
</td></tr></table>
</form>
上部にユーザー コントロールが登録されています。
<%@ Register TagName="menu" TagPrefix="sidenav" Src="~/Common_UC/Menu_Sidenav.ascx"%>
しかし、私は得ています
Error 543 Unknown server tag 'sidenav:menu'
ユーザーコントロールは適切な場所にあり、他のすべては問題ないようです。何か不足していますか?
更新: gbs がコメントで述べたように、問題は私の UC 自体にありました。それ自体にビルドエラーがあったため、エラーメッセージが表示された可能性があります(今はテストできません。コードがありません:()